Three arrested in death of Spring Valley man


UNION-TRIBUNE BREAKING NEWS TEAM

5:30 p.m. July 23, 2008

SAN DIEGO – Authorities have arrested three people in the December death of a Spring Valley man, officials said Wednesday.

Tobias Romero and Rodolfo Anguiano, both 26, are suspected of murder in connection with the death of Jose Lua on Dec. 22.

The third man arrested, 27-year-old Reynaldo Romero, a brother of Tobias Romero, is suspected of conspiracy and making terrorist threats, deputies said. He was already in custody on an an unrelated crime.

All three are residents of San Diego County, said sheriff's Sgt. Roy Frank.

Lua, who was in his early 30s, was found dead in Anguiano's apartment on Dale Drive. Anguiano called sheriff's deputies to report Lua was dead.

Detectives said Lua did not live at the apartment. He was an acquaintance of one of the men arrested, Frank said.

Frank said that sheriff's officials are not releasing information on the cause or manner of Lua's death, but he said that circumstances of the death “appear to be drug-related.”
